Yog for Emotional Stability рднाрд╡рдиाрдд्рдордХ рд╕्рдеिрд░рддा рдХे рд▓िрдП рдпोрдЧ In today’s fast-paced and stressful life, emotional stability is more important than ever. Yoga provides powerful tools to calm the mind, regulate emotions, and handle stress effectively. By practicing specific Yogic techniques, you can manage anger, anxiety, and tension, creating a more balanced inner life. 1. Breath Control (рдк्рд░ाрдгाрдпाрдо) ЁЯМм️ Conscious breathing is key to calming a restless mind. Techniques such as Anulom Vilom (alternate nostril breathing) or deep belly breathing help reduce anxiety and bring a sense of inner equilibrium. Practicing breath control daily enhances focus and steadies emotional reactions. 2. Focused Meditation (рдз्рдпाрди) ЁЯзШ Meditation allows you to observe your emotions without being swept away by them.
